Software Engineer
Headquartered in Sarasota – Florida, Global Ordnance LLC (GlobalOrdnance.com & Global-Ordnance.com) is a force multiplier within the commercial and defense military industries supporting a wide array of equipment, ammunition and firearms. As a Veteran Owned Small Business, Global Ordnance LLC strives to provide excellence to our customers with unparalleled integrity of values and the loyalty expected.
Global Ordnance LLC has spent years building relationships with global manufacturers and distributors of ammunition, firearms and equipment for our military and law enforcement contracts. These relationships along with Global Ordnance's understanding of customer needs within the defense industry has served as our natural foundation in the civilian marketplace. Thus, expanding into the commercial sale of ammunition, firearms, and complimentary equipment to the savants of the shooting industry or the novice hobbyist. From match grade hunting ammunition, competition, self-defense or everyday target shooting, Global Ordnance orders can be made from the convenience and comfort of your home here at http://www.globalordnance.com
Position Summary
The Software Engineer is responsible for developing, integrating, and sustaining software components that support a complex defense weapon system across prototype development, test support, and production readiness. This role focuses on reliable, secure, and maintainable software that supports system functionality, interfaces, and Government requirements. The Software Engineer works closely with systems, electrical, and mechanical engineers to ensure software aligns with system architecture, configuration baselines, and operational needs.
Key Responsibilities
• Compliance with ITAR, DFAR, and any other relevant regulations and policies.
• Design, develop, test, and maintain software components supporting weapon system functionality and interfaces
• Support integration of software with electrical and mechanical subsystems
• Develop and maintain software requirements, design documentation, and verification artifacts
• Support configuration management and software change control processes
• Participate in system engineering reviews including SRR, PDR, CDR, and test readiness reviews
• Support Governmentled test and evaluation activities, including test preparation and issue resolution
• Perform software debugging, root cause analysis, and corrective actions during integration and testing
• Ensure compliance with Government requirements, cybersecurity standards, and applicable MILSTDs
• Support software transition from prototype to production environments
• Coordinate with subcontractors and suppliers providing softwareenabled components
• Other project and work as assigned by management
Required Qualifications
• Candidates must be ITAR Authorized US Persons
• Must be lawfully permitted and comfortable working in facilities that handle firearms and munitions.
• Must be willing to travel on average 2530%, both internationally and domestic, travel may vary based on business needs.
• Bachelor’s degree in Software Engineering, Computer Engineering, Computer Science, or related discipline
• Minimum of 5 years of experience developing software for defense, aerospace, or safetycritical systems
• Experience with embedded software development or systemlevel software integration
• Familiarity with realtime operating systems, communications protocols, or hardwaresoftware interfaces
• Strong understanding of software development lifecycle (SDLC) and configuration management
• Proficiency in one or more programming languages commonly used in embedded or system software environments
• Strong problemsolving and communication skills
Preferred Qualifications
• Experience supporting weapon systems, fire control, or safetycritical applications
• Familiarity with cybersecurity requirements (e.g., RMF, secure coding practices)
• Experience supporting Government test programs and technical reviews
• Experience transitioning software from prototype to production
• Active or eligible U.S. security clearance
Work Environment
This role supports a hands-on engineering program and requires collaboration across multiple disciplines and facilities. Occasional travel to manufacturing sites and Government test locations may be required.
This job description is not intended to be all-inclusive, and employees will also perform other reasonably related business duties as assigned by immediate supervisor and other management as required.
Global Ordnance reserves the right to revise or change job duties and descriptions as the need arises. This job description does not constitute a written or implied contract of employment. As all employment with Global Ordnance LLC is At-Will and no part of this job description constitutes any promise of continued employment or employment contract.
Global Ordnance, LLC is an Equal Opportunity Employer and do not discriminate in recruitment, hiring, training, promotion, or other employment practices for reasons of race, color, religion, gender, sexual orientation, national origin, age, marital or veteran status, medical condition or disability, or any other legally protected status.
Defense and Space Manufacturing
Engineering and Information Technology
Full-time